Product Description
The HP L01100-001 is a 256GB M.2 2280 Solid State Drive (SSD) designed for high-performance computing. It utilizes the PCI Express (PCIe) interface, specifically leveraging the NVMe protocol, which allows for significantly faster data transfer speeds compared to traditional SATA-based SSDs. The M.2 2280 form factor is compact and commonly found in modern laptops, ultrabooks, and small form-factor desktops, enabling efficient use of space. This SSD is engineered to deliver rapid boot times, quick application loading, and swift file transfers. The NVMe protocol is optimized for flash storage, reducing latency and increasing throughput by allowing for a higher number of command queues and a greater depth of commands per queue compared to the AHCI protocol used by SATA drives. This results in a more responsive user experience and improved overall system performance.
